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Find everything you need to get certified on Fabric—skills challenges, live sessions, exam prep, role guidance, and more. Get started

Reply
WM117
Frequent Visitor

Connecting multiple Google Analytics accounts (Google accounts) to 1 PowerBI report in PowerQuery

Hi Everybody,

 

Situation: 

I am making a Google Analytics(GA) report for a company. This company has several units that each use a different Google-account for their online-marketing. It seems that I need to log-in seperately to each google-account if i want to access the GA-data. each account seperately works fine, however when i want to connect the multiple google accounts to my report only the account to which i am logged on to works. 

 

Is there a way to connect various Google-accounts to a single PowerBI report? If there is not, do you have some ideas for work arounds? For example, bringing the data from the various google-accounts to a single database and connect the database to PowerBI? Or maybe a piece of manual code that enables me to access multiple accounts? 

 

Thanks in advance!

 

Willem

2 REPLIES 2
CoderZen08
Helper IV
Helper IV

Hi, @WM117 were you able to find a solution? As a workaround, maybe you can try to test your connection with a 3rd party connector. I currently use windsor.ai's GA connector and I can export directly many different GA account's data at once to PBI. In case you wonder, to make the connection first search for the Salesforce connector in the data sources list:

 

GA4-1.png

 

After that, just grant access to your Salesforce account using your credentials, then on preview and destination page you will see a preview of your Salesforce fields:

 

GA4-2.png

 

There just select the fields you need. It is also compatible with custom fields and custom objects, so you'll be able to export them through windsor.  Finally, just select PBI as your data destination and finally just copy and paste the url on PBI --> Get Data --> Web --> Paste the url. 

 

SELECT_DESTINATION_NEW.png

amustafa
Super User
Super User

In Power BI service, you can create a different Dataflow for each account then create one Datamart from different Dataflows and then Power BI report from this one Datamart.





Did I answer your question? Mark my post as a solution!

Proud to be a Super User!




Helpful resources

Announcements
Sept PBI Carousel

Power BI Monthly Update - September 2024

Check out the September 2024 Power BI update to learn about new features.

September Hackathon Carousel

Microsoft Fabric & AI Learning Hackathon

Learn from experts, get hands-on experience, and win awesome prizes.

Sept NL Carousel

Fabric Community Update - September 2024

Find out what's new and trending in the Fabric Community.

Top Solution Authors